The Dark Galleries

DirectorNicolas Provost

11 min

A fascinating hall of mirrors through a montage of film noir scenes where the actors face a painted portrait. This perfect blend of cinema and painting was commissioned to supplement a book study. Provost exploits the rules of editing to create an imaginary museum visit. He guides us through living rooms and picture galleries of 1940s and 1950s noir crime thrillers, gothic melodramas, and ghost stories.
